    Dewald Brevis century Bangladesh 3 Feb 22

    Brilliant Brevis breaks U19 World Cup record

    Dewald Brevis’ 138 against Bangladesh on Thursday took his tally for this year’s U19 World Cup to 506 runs in six innings at an average of 84.33.

    Allahudien Paleker

    SA umpire set for Test debut after 15-year journey

    Allahudien Paleker will become South Africa’s 57th Test umpire when he makes his debut at the Wanderers on Monday.
